Position Purpose:
In coordination with Plant Manager the incumbent will be responsible for providing the day to day oversight of department staff, shift operations, troubleshoot equipment problems and generate work orders as needed, as well as providing operational, commercial and personnel leadership to the plant shift operating teams to maintain efficient and cost effective facility operations while maintaining compliance with all Corporate and Regulatory environmental, health and safety rules and requirements.
Primary Duties/Responsibilities:
Supervises a staff of Plant Operators - trainees, 1A licensed Operators, 2A licensed Operators and 3A licensed Operators and directs their daily duties in accordance with the requirements of the Plant.
Work with other plant departments, Engineering, and contractors to coordinate projects.
Lead and guide shift crews to monitor all facets of plant operations and incoming data.
Ability to stand watch on an assigned Operation station in the event of emergency or staffing issues.
Reviews all operations station worksheets for anomalies and errors.
Checks worksheets prior to entering data or turning over for data entry into Hach Wims.
Assists operations staff with troubleshooting operational issues.
Performs visual observations of the various process areas over the course of the shift to ensure all compliance and safety measures are being met.
Ability to process laboratory data to make process control change suggestions.
Ability to calculate MCRT, SVI, Detention Time, Hydraulic Loading and other related process control measures.
Maintains a log book for plant operations during assigned shift
Manage, evaluate, schedule, and develop the O&M staff and always ensure adequate staffing.
Coordinate alternate staff in the event of absences following the Overtime equalization policy.
Provides leadership and directing in response to alarms and abnormal conditions and lead emergency response actions.
Independently evaluates and/or supervises the evaluation of the operation, maintenance and performance of wastewater treatment facilities, processes, systems, and equipment.
Reviews, and supervises implementation of system improvements including analyzing and optimizing existing system designs and operating parameters, supervising performance testing and troubleshooting and resolving complex operational, equipment and instrumentation problems.
Reviews designs and constructed facilities and makes and approves recommendations for operational improvements.
Oversees construction management personnel in implementing changes required during facilities upgrades and startup, supervises the work of operational services, treatment plant construction personnel in startup and initial operation of new or upgraded wastewater treatment facilities, processes, systems, and equipment.
Participate in the development and compliance of operating policies ensuring compliance to all environmental and safety rules.
Complete reports which document plant status, equipment, operating data, and operational events.
Collect data on unplanned outages and make recommendations to minimize the probability of similar events.
Serves as the real-time shift interface with the Commercial Group with respect to plant operations, outages, fuel, generations schedules.
Perform Issuer and Verifier functions utilizing the approved Lock Out/Tag Out systems to help ensure that safe systems are always in place.
Manage Department contract deliverables and scheduling.
Responsible for ordering of materials and supplies.
Ensures all equipment and processes are well maintained and functioning properly.
Ensure that workstations and Treatment plant facilities are clean and safe in accordance with all regulatory requirements.
Maintain proper operational documents and records.
Assure work is performed in a safe and professional manner by following all corporate and regulatory policies, procedures, and emergency response procedures.
Operates equipment and processes manually and through instrument control panels.
Work an assigned shift which may include weekends and holidays, Respond to emergencies, work additional hours to complete required tasks as/and when needed.
Operate company and client owned vehicles.
Carries out other duties as assigned.
Work Environment:
Work is performed both inside and outside with exposure to all kinds of weather conditions.
Incumbents may be occasionally exposed to some noise, sewage, silica, dust, fumes, smoke, gasses, greases, oils, electrical energy, solvents, and vibrations.
Incumbents may work on slippery/uneven surfaces, around machinery with moving parts, moving objects/vehicles, and ladder/scaffolding, below ground and may be exposed to water and other liquid materials.

Position Purpose:
The Supervisor of Meter Services, New York Division is responsible for the overall environment of the Meter Department, including office(s) and field service operations for the New York Municipal Water Division of Veolia. The role will provide direct supervision to the Westchester Meter Department, including a foreperson and 10 Servicepersons. The Supervisor will also assist, as needed, and support the day-to-day operations of the Rockland meter department consisting of a Leader and 14 Commercial Service Representatives. Reporting directly to the Manager of Metering, the Supervisor will also assist in the oversight of meter installation vendors, contacts with the NY regulator , and take the lead on special projects and corporate initiatives. This may also include supporting the Owego and Rhode Island metering functions.
Primary Duties/Responsibilities:
Manage the annual meter testing program mandated by the NYS Public Service Commission (PSC) for Veolia Water New York, Inc. and submit results to the PSC on a quarterly basis.
Manage the yearly compliance meter change programs, developing plans to complete the required annual work, including but not limited to customer contacts, appointment schedules, meter orders, and resolving field related issue(s) timely.
Manage the installation of meters for new properties and work closely with the New Business and Planning Departments to ensure customer needs are met timely.
Schedule and supervise daily field work and field staff including weekly field visits to ensure all field staff members are following all safety standards, as well as, optimally routing their work orders to ensure efficiencies.
Manage call escalations for customers with appointments, and scheduling conflicts.
Manage the meter reading schedules and staff to ensure all cycles are read timely and within appropriate bill windows in CC&B while minimizing estimated reads for the NY Division.
Daily reporting on key performance indicators to upper-level management either via email, tracking spreadsheet or other programs.
Manage all daily / weekly / monthly INCOME controls for auditing purposes for all meter departments/BU's.
Complete backflow certification in New York State and effectively manage Veolia' cross connection control program to ensure backflow devices for all customers meet regulations of NY State.
Work closely with the Non-Revenue Water Management Team to provide input and gather information for various non-revenue water initiatives.
Assist, as needed, with coverage of the Customer Service Department in Veolia Water New York, Inc. companies.
As requested, manage other initiatives such as, but not limited to, Strategic Metering, Advanced Metering Infrastructure and Automating Work Order Management.
Work closely with all meter contractors to meet project objectives timely, track project completion and drive positive results.
Computer skills are required.
Incumbent must have a passion for serving customers and providing an exceptional customer experience.
Emergency Supervisor on call rotation required in Westchester. May be asked to provide coverage as needed in other office locations when deemed necessary.
Work closely with Human Resources and Collective Bargaining Union Representatives as it relates to employee/disciplinary matters or concerns.
